What NASCAR Playoff bubble drivers are saying at Phoenix

By Pat DeCola | Published: November 11, 2017 16

On Sunday, five drivers enter Phoenix Raceway with a shot ... but only one of them will walk away with a berth to the Championship 4 next weekend at Miami.

Here's what Ryan Blaney, Chase Elliott, Denny Hamlin, Jimmie Johnson and Brad Keselowski are saying before the Round of 8 finale (2:30 p.m. ET, NBC, MRN, SiriusXM).

Chase Elliott

On his approach to Phoenix cutoff race

'Our task at hand is pretty simple, we have to win the race to move on next week. ... We are going to try to attack the weekend as best we can.'

Jimmie Johnson

On his approach to Phoenix cutoff race

'It's a pretty easy approach for us. We're in a must-win-situation. We wish we were in a better points scenario, but that's not the case. This team thrives on pressure and adversity and we're certainly in the position right now.'

Jimmie Johnson

On how stressful it is to be in a must-win situation

'I feel like the Round of 8, in my mind and the way I've approached it, has been a must-win, period. I look at Martinsville and I look at Texas and then I didn't want to be in a position here to need points, because if you're here needing points, you've got to win.'

Jimmie Johnson

On what Chase Elliott's chances are

'I think the No. 24 car has always had a good set-up here. I think of Jeff's (Gordon) history here and Chase. Alan (Gustafson, crew chief) and Chase both have a good feel for this track. Inherently, Alan and Chad (Knaus, crew chief) have some different concepts with their cars and where their cars go, so I can't say our cars are identical. But, I feel Chase's chances are high.'

Ryan Blaney

On the odds he can make it to Miami on points

'You never know what can happen. If you go and you get a good couple stages in, you and the 11 (of Denny Hamlin) or the 2 (of Brad Keselowski) don't have very good stages, you might be right there.'

Brad Keselowski

On if he can make it to Miami from a starting position of 16th

'We'll find out. It’s a short race and if there's a track to qualify well this is one of them. It's not where we want to start, but when the track gets hot and slick we seem to run better here than when it cools off at night. I don't know, maybe that's my style.'
